We only run  few unique challenging Expeditions each year which are all in the most challenging and remote areas of the World. As well as having long phone call discussions with out potential Expedition Team members we also try to meet everyone in person prior to a Expedition. For our more serious Expeditions we include a two week training expedition 6-12 month before the big one.

However, due to feed back where many off you have expressed a wish to get to know us and hear more about our challenges and expeditions and what is involved. We especially get lots of questions around the physical nature of our journeys.

Therefore we have decided to run 1000 Mile Journeys intro weekends at various locations around the UK and overseas.

These weekends will be two day events where we will walk and talk, or cycle and talk. or paddle and talk! Basically you get to meet us and us you and ask as many questions as you want of us. We are there of course to help and advise on the mental and physical preparation that you should undertake prior to a expedition.

There is no charge or cost to these weekends apart from your own personal costs. Each weekend will be hosted by one of our guides for the two days. Depending on location and time of year we may camp or use bunkhouses etc.

We will host the weekends for groups of 4-12 with one guide and two guides if up to 20 are interested.
